A two-day ceramics fair is coming, raising funds to provide a heritage plaque commemorating mid-century ceramic design pioneers, Troika.

The fair will take place at The Cornerstone, St Ives Library, on 30th and 31st May.
Each day there will be talks, presented by Ben Harris, co-author of Troika 63-83, and Madie Parkinson-Evans, currently researching the decorators and employees
On 30th May, at 11am, there will be a talk on Troika, The Early Years, then the following day, at 2pm, the subject will be Troika, Building on Success at Newlyn.
Tickets cost £8 and can be purchased from St Ives Box Office.
The heritage plaque would be placed at Wheal Dream, now the site of the St Ives Museum.
